Wesleyan Shut Out by Yellow Jackets in MEC Battle

The Wesleyan women's soccer team suffered a tough home loss on Sunday afternoon, falling 4-0 to West Virginia State in a Mountain East Conference (MEC) match up at Culpepper Stadium.
 
State opened the scoring in the 18th minute on a strike from Laura Pouedras, assisted by Maria Alejandra Hernandez Diaz. Just seven minutes later, Sara París Fílter capitalized on a defensive lapse to double the Yellow Jackets' lead.
 
Despite multiple first-half saves from senior goalkeeper Maite Coutinho, the Bobcats entered halftime trailing 2-0 and struggling to gain a foothold in the midfield.
 
The Bobcats could not generate consistent offensive threats, managing only four total shots, two of which were on goal. Ava Badallo and Hannah Murphy recorded the only shots on target.
 
Wesleyan travels to Glenville State University on Wednesday, Sept. 24 for a 6 p.m. match against the Pioneers.
